Sportingās new primary jersey, which features a return of the iconic Sporting Blue and Dark Indigo horizontal stripes, showcases The Victory Project on the front with Childrenās Mercy onthe left sleeve and Compass Minerals on the right sleeve. This marks the first time in MLS history that a charitable foundation will appear on the front of a teamās full-season jerseys.
As part of the new community campaign called āA Force for Good,ā a portion of all Sporting Kansas City kit sales in 2021 will be donated to The Victory Project.
Building on the heritage and culture of a popular look for Sporting, the clubās new 2021 primary kit is an evolution of the hooped 2014-15 and 2016-17 secondary jerseys. The horizontal stripes of Sporting Blue and Dark Indigo celebrate the timeless tradition of hooped soccer jerseys worldwide.
Among the kitās finer details, the signature adidas Three Stripes run along the shoulders, the back neck features argyle SKC initials, and the interior back neckline showcases the āTwo States, One City, One Clubā mantra. Sporting Blue shorts and socks round out the new primary uniform.
Sportingās secondary jersey, featuring a Dark Indigo base and Sporting Blue Swiss dots, will return for the 2021 season, this time with The Victory Project on the front and Childrenās Mercy on the left sleeve. For the second straight year, Compass Minerals will feature a patch on the right sleeve of Sportingās primary and secondary jerseys as part of a long-term partnership as the clubās official plant nutrition and salt provider.
Sporting has joined The Victory Project and Childrenās Mercy Kansas City to launch āA Force for Good,ā a community initiative that will coincide with the clubās landmark 25-year anniversary in Major League Soccer. To kick off the campaign, Sporting unveiled the clubās new 2021 primary kit today when Childrenās Mercy patients and staff donned the jersey at the state-of-the-art Childrenās Mercy Research Institute in Kansas City, Missouri.
Over the course of 2021, āA Force for Goodā will see The Victory Project grow its commitment to helping children and join forces with local partners to meet crucial community needs. The campaign will focus on four key platforms:
- The Victory Project and Childrenās Mercy will remain aligned in helping kids fighting cancer on a daily basis.
- Sporting Wishes: As a flagship program of The Victory Project, Sporting Wishes fulfills wishes for children who relapse or are diagnosed with a secondary cancer. In 2021, the initiative will continue to make dreams come true as The Victory Project grants major wishes to children of all ages and backgrounds.
- Soccer for All Kids: The Victory Project will make the sport of soccer more accessible to children with limited financial resources. This includes working with partners, non-profits, schools and other entities to bring soccer programs to kids who have not had these opportunities before.
- Sporting Community Kitchen: Sporting Community Kitchen launched in April 2020, distributing over 30,000 free meals to Kansas City residents affected by the COVID-19 pandemic last spring. The initiative will return in a new format for 2021 as Sporting provides meals for children and families in need.
